Getting It Together Strolling up and down the make- shift aisles at the garage sale, you are surrounded by thousands of old baseball cards and other memorabilia. It all reminds you of the baseball cards you collected when you were six. You hurry home and search through the attic for your favorite Willie Mays and Mickey Mantle cards. After two hours, you find them and figure that they are worth ten times as much as they were the day you pulled them from their wrappers or traded for them with your best friend. 4 i Collecting has been a hobby for years, and many students discovered the challenge of col- lecting everything from old coins to stuffed animals. I ' ve been collecting baseball cards since I was five, mentioned Don McGlamery. I have about 5,000 cards going back about ten years. Stamps and coins as well as baseball cards increased in value as the years passed. Joe Parlette said, I ' ve been col- lecting coins for about six years. It is a hobby that I ' ve al- ways been interested in, and I have many valuable coins. Instead of being profitable, some collections were just for looks. Charles Waite com- mented, I have a collection of beer bottles from all over the world. It is really good look- ing. Chris Whiting added, My sports uniform number has always been 26 so I collect anything with the number 26 on it. As you open Christmas mail, you notice a Bolivian stamp on one of the letters. You grab a pair of scissors and cut the stamp out. Then you search your closet for the rest of your collection and mount the stamp, hoping that it will in- crease the value of your collec- tion.
